A FORMER leader of Ribble Valley Council has taken up his new role as the mayor for the next 12 months.
Coun John Hill has represented Read and Simonstone for the past nine years.
Cardiff-born John was scrum-half at Clitheroe Rugby Club in the 1980s and was a main player in the construction of the club's former pavilion.
During his leadership of the council, which came to an end at last year's local elections, he launched a grand tour of parish councils and community groups in a battle bus in a bid to take local government back to the people.
He takes over from Coun Doreen Taylor, Clayton-le-Dale.
At the event it was announced chief executive David Morris would be retiring next April. Council leader Coun Michael Ranson thanked him for his hard work.
